Centre Furnace Mansion Historic Site

  • 1001 E. College Ave.
  • State College, PA 16801
  • Phone: 814-234-4779
Tour the historic mansion, gardens and iron furnace site associated with the Centre Furnace, established in 1791. Here in 1855, owners James Irvin and Moses Thompson gifted 200 acres of Centre Furnace land to establish "Farmers High School" - today known as Penn State University.
